www.zhifeiya.cn

敲码拾光专注于编程技术,涵盖编程语言、代码实战案例、软件开发技巧、IT前沿技术、编程开发工具,是您提升技术能力的优质网络平台。

Database 即数据库,是按照一定的数据结构来组织、存储和管理数据的仓库,它可以让用户高效地进行数据的插入、查询、更新和删除等操作,为各种应用程序提供数据支持,确保数据的安全性、完整性和一致性,常见的有 MySQL、Oracle、SQL Server 等关系型数据库以及 MongoDB 等非关系型数据库。

MySQL日期时间处理函数使用不当的常见问题及解决

本文深入解析MySQL日期时间处理中的常见陷阱,包括时区转换错误、月末日期计算误区及隐式转换导致的性能问题。通过电商系统真实案例,详解CONVERT_TZ时区校正、LAST_DAY函数防越界技巧、索引优化方案,提供时间维度表设计与防御性编程实战经验,涵盖日期范围查询优化、闰年处理策略和存储类型选型对比,助力开发者彻底规避时间处理隐患,提升数据库操作效率和系统可靠性。
MySQL Database T-SQL

SQLServer数据备份与恢复过程中的常见问题处理

SQL Server数据备份与恢复,深度解析高频故障场景,涵盖备份失败、日志暴增、跨版本恢复等棘手问题。通过T-SQL代码示例详解磁盘空间告警处理、恢复性能优化40%的实战技巧,提供备份加密配置、云端混合存储方案及事务日志紧急收缩指南。文章包含备份验证原则、恢复时效SLA标准及损坏文件分阶段抢救策略,特别分享AlwaysOn高可用架构设计要点,助您构建企业级容灾体系,规避数据丢失风险,提升数据库运维可靠性。
Database Sqlserver BackUp T-SQL

剖析MySQL表结构陷阱:索引缺失、大字段、过度范式化、数据类型不当产生隐式损耗及错误范式

本文深度剖析MySQL表结构设计中的五大性能陷阱:索引缺失引发全表扫描、大字段滥用导致存储膨胀、过度范式化带来的多表关联灾难、数据类型不当产生隐式损耗及错误范式应用。通过电商订单、论坛系统等真实案例,详解索引优化法则、垂直分表策略、反范式化技巧及IP存储方案,提供执行计划分析、压力测试等优化工具指南,助力开发者规避性能陷阱,掌握从索引设计、字段拆解到范式平衡的全套表结构优化方法论,打造高性能数据库架构。
MySQL Database HighAvailability HighConcurrency InnoDB T-SQL

MongoDB字段类型转换引发的常见问题及解决方法

本文深度剖析MongoDB字段类型转换的核心痛点,揭示数字类型陷阱、日期时区危机、数组结构异变等典型问题场景。通过聚合管道转换、Schema校验防御、批量迁移优化等实战方案,提供从预防到治理的完整类型管理策略。涵盖Mongoose模式校验、数据类型决策树、ETL工具选型等关键技术,助力开发者规避数据查询失效、统计异常、性能损耗等隐患,建立可持续演进的数据治理体系。
Database NoSql MongoDB Mongoose

讲解SQLServer数据库文件损坏以及修复工具的使用与操作流程的应用

SQL Server数据库文件损坏急救,深度解析823/824错误解决方案,详解DBCC CHECKDB紧急修复与ApexSQL等第三方工具实战流程。从页面级恢复到日志重建,提供不同损坏程度的修复策略对照表,揭秘如何通过PowerShell精准修复数据页。涵盖备份优先原则、修复验证流程及性能监控技巧,分享电商平台4小时恢复1.2TB数据库的实战案例,助您掌握"官方工具+商业软件"组合拳,最大限度保障数据完整性的同时实现快速恢复。
Database Sqlserver Exception PowerShell DBCC ApexSQL

如何通过“连接字符串参数调优、慢查询精准定位,连接池动态管理、TCP/IP网络层优化”等手段解决SQLServer连接超时问题

解决SQL Server数据库连接超时问题?本文从连接字符串参数调优到慢查询精准定位,详解连接池动态管理技巧与TCP/IP网络层优化,揭秘资源调控器的使用姿势。通过电商、金融等真实案例,展示如何通过查询优化降低72%超时率,利用监控体系构建预警防线。涵盖基础配置、高级资源管控及架构演进路线,助您快速诊断连接瓶颈,打造高可用数据库系统。无论是DBA还是开发者,都能获得即学即用的调优指南。
Database Sqlserver T-SQL ADO

SQLServer数据迁移的错误,通过BULK INSERT日志分析、TRY/CATCH异常捕获、事务复制急救等解决方案详解

SQL Server表数据复制错误处理的策略与实战,深度解析数据迁移中的典型故障场景,提供BULK INSERT日志分析、TRY/CATCH异常捕获、事务复制急救方案等全栈解决方案。涵盖数据类型冲突、主键重复、分布式事务等六大特殊场景处理技巧,结合金融系统迁移失败案例与电商亿级数据回滚实战复盘,详解性能优化参数配置与区块链日志审计等前沿技术,助您构建从错误预防到智能自愈的完整防御体系,保障数据迁移零失误。
Database Sqlserver BackUp DevOps

深度解析MongoDB数据分片数据倾斜的常见问题及均衡方法

MongoDB分片集群数据倾斜调优指南,深度解析分布式数据库负载不均难题,从分片键选择误区到自动均衡器配置,揭秘时序数据、社交网络、金融交易三大场景的最佳实践。通过电商爆单、游戏分区等真实案例,提供分片键改造、手动迁移、监控预警等解决方案,助您突破Jumbo chunks困局,实现从"头重脚轻"到智能均衡的运维蜕变。
Database NoSql MongoDB DevOps

聊聊MongoDB的TTL索引延迟背后的原理和数据过期删除的时钟精度、调度机制

本文深入解析MongoDB数据过期删除的时钟精度与调度机制,揭秘TTL索引延迟背后的核心原理。通过Node.js代码示例展示时间戳精度优化方案,探讨分片集群并行删除与外部调度系统的整合策略,提供物联网日志清洗等真实场景解决方案。文章对比毫秒/微秒时间戳的存储效能,剖析动态TTL索引的创建技巧,并给出不同数据规模下的优化路线图,帮助开发者有效解决存储空间浪费和查询性能下降难题,实现精准可控的数据生命周期管理。
Database NoSql MongoDB TTL

C#中使用System.Data.SqlClient连接到SQLServer数据库的连接字符串设置?

本文深入解析C#通过System.Data.SqlClient连接SQL Server的核心技术,详解连接字符串的参数配置、安全加密与性能优化技巧,提供集成Windows认证、连接池配置及MARS等实战代码示例。涵盖企业级Web应用、桌面程序及数据分析场景的最佳实践,剖析SqlConnectionStringBuilder动态构建方法,强调连接字符串安全存储与异常处理要点,并拓展EF Core与Dapper的整合方案,助开发者打造高效可靠的数据库访问基础架构。
Database Sqlserver C# EF

MySQL中GROUP BY子句性能差的优化方法

本文深入剖析MySQL中GROUP BY的性能瓶颈,通过电商平台真实案例揭示执行原理与六大核心优化方案。详解索引优化、预计算策略、分布式处理等技术,提供参数调优指南与查询重构技巧,并给出方案选型矩阵与避坑指南。涵盖从百万级到亿级数据的实战优化策略,结合MySQL 8.0新特性与列式存储演进方向,为高并发场景下的分组统计提供全链路性能提升解决方案。
MySQL Database HighAvailability HighConcurrency

通过MySQL数据库文件损坏恢复讲解“错误日志分析、mysqlcheck检测到Percona数据恢复”等技术手段

“本文深度解析MySQL数据库文件损坏紧急救援全流程,从错误日志分析、mysqlcheck检测到Percona数据恢复工具实战,详解InnoDB强制修复、单表救援及ibd文件重建技术。通过电商平台真实案例(99.3%数据恢复率),对比四种恢复方案优劣,提供RAID故障应对策略、ZFS文件系统选型建议及备份验证方法,助DBA快速定位‘Table is marked as crashed’等故障,有效实施从磁盘级备份到表结构重建的全链路数据抢救方案。”
MySQL Database BackUp InnoDB

SQLServer备份压缩失败的常见问题及参数调整

本文深度解析SQL Server备份压缩失败的八大常见原因,涵盖硬件资源瓶颈、版本兼容性陷阱及备份加密影响等核心问题。通过12个实战示例详解MAXTRANSFERSIZE、BUFFERCOUNT等关键参数调优技巧,提供SQL Server 2019至2022版本的优化方案。内容包含空间预警机制、并行备份策略及智能压缩技术,助您有效解决"磁盘空间不足"、"CPU过载"等典型故障,掌握压缩率与性能平衡的黄金法则,成为数据库备份领域的调优专家。
Database Sqlserver BackUp DevOps

在C#中使用MySqlConnector对MySQL数据进行更新和删除操作

本指南详细讲解C#通过MySqlConnector实现MySQL数据更新与删除的全流程,涵盖参数化查询防止SQL注入、事务批量操作、级联删除等核心技巧,提供电商库存更新、用户管理系统等实战场景代码示例。对比Dapper/EF性能差异,解析连接池优化和超时控制策略,助力.NET开发者高效安全操作数据库,适合需要精准控制SQL语句的中大型项目应用。
MySQL Database C# EF Dapper

解决MySQL存储过程递归错误和栈溢出问题:调整系统变量、迭代算法替代递归、CTE递归查询

本文深入解析MySQL存储过程递归调用引发的栈溢出问题,探讨通过调整系统变量、迭代算法替代递归、CTE递归查询三种解决方案。详细对比存储过程递归、迭代方法和CTE递归在深度查询、版本兼容性及执行效率等方面的差异,提供临时表优化、深度控制机制及压力测试方案,并针对MySQL 8.0+环境给出CTE标准语法的最佳实践,为处理组织架构、权限体系等树形数据查询提供性能优化指导与系统级问题防范策略。
MySQL Database Exception StoredProcedure

在C#中,使用MySqlConnector时遇到MySQL数据库锁问题该如何处理?

本文深入探讨C#与MySqlConnector解决MySQL数据库锁的实战策略,涵盖快照读、乐观锁、死锁处理等核心技巧。通过Dapper框架演示如何在库存扣减等高并发场景中优化事务隔离级别、实现版本号控制,详解锁监控工具与三重优化境界。针对MySQL 8.0的InnoDB引擎特性,提供索引优化指南、分布式锁扩展方案及五大避坑守则,助力开发者有效应对"Lock wait timeout"问题,提升系统并发处理能力,打造流畅数据库访问体验。
MySQL Database Lock InnoDB C# Dapper

SQL Server视图更新数据报错的常见问题分析与解决

SQL Server视图数据更新报错,深度解析视图更新经典报错场景,涵盖计算列陷阱、多表更新限制及WITH CHECK OPTION约束等问题。提供INSTEAD OF触发器编写、存储过程封装、索引视图优化等高阶解决方案,总结视图更新边界控制、事务安全机制等最佳实践,助DBA快速定位视图更新故障根源,掌握跨表数据联动修改技巧,规避性能陷阱,实现高效安全的视图数据操作。
Database Sqlserver DevOps T-SQL View

深度解析MongoDB数据安全机制,揭秘文档更新中的原子操作与事务并发控制

通过电商库存扣减、资金转账等实战场景,剖析$inc运算符、findAndModify和事务方案的优劣对比,详解乐观锁版本控制与悲观锁应用策略。结合性能测试数据与血泪教训,给出8大最佳实践,帮助开发者在高并发场景下有效防止数据覆盖、保证操作原子性,平衡数据库性能与数据一致性需求。
Database NoSql Transaction MongoDB findAndModify

剖析MySQL存储过程中变量作用域的三大类型(用户变量、局部变量、参数变量)及其常见使用误区

本文深度剖析MySQL存储过程中变量作用域的三大类型,通过多个真实案例演示变量覆盖、作用域混淆、参数消失等典型问题。提供命名规范、作用域控制技巧及调试方法,详解OUT参数处理、动态SQL变量传递等进阶技巧,助您避开隐式错误陷阱,优化存储过程性能。包含实战生存法则和最佳实践指南,是MySQL开发者必备的变量作用域避坑手册。
MySQL Database StoredProcedure T-SQL

SQLServer日志增长过快的三大元凶:未提交事务、恢复模式陷阱与索引维护日志

本文深度解析SQL Server日志暴增三大元凶:未提交事务、恢复模式陷阱与索引维护雪崩效应,揭秘事务拆分、精准收缩等实战驯服技巧。详解AlwaysOn可用性组与日志传送管理方案,对比四种技术方案优缺点,提供磁盘布局黄金法则与自动化监控脚本。从预警机制到版本差异应对,囊括DBA血泪经验总结,助你彻底根治日志膨胀顽疾,告别深夜磁盘告警噩梦!
Database Sqlserver Transaction DevOps